Transaction abb78a72e2bec303143a2e4bd84d3739e9166c4d9c54b2f3f50c8a0aa6a3fd9e
1 Input
1 Output
-
abb78a72e2bec303143a2e4bd84d3739e9166c4d9c54b2f3f50c8a0aa6a3fd9e:0
- value
- 19365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3a132f1112f6c0c3dacb066a24f2e6be0481ac OP_EQUAL
- address
- 3L8HzQnNmPx2ZQ85y1UViFDpBD9cE1Mr9Y